ambertreesap | Oct 30, 2018

Camera policy is up to the artist. Phones and point and shoot cameras have been allowed at every show I've attended there. Some have asked for no tripods or cameras with exchangeable lenses. The box office should know on the day of the show the camera policy for that event.
